Brooke Alexandra: When I was 16, I would get these effortless big, fat ringlets (I'm Israeli-American and have coarse 3b/3c curls that go about three inches past my collar bone). I was using the original Wet brush and whatever leave-in conditioner my mom with thin, pin-straight hair happened to have in the bathroom. Around the time I turned 17, I decided it was time to replace my brush (note I kept the Wet brush I was using in a drawer). Thinking all plastic-bristle brushes were the same, I tried a Conair brush, and seemingly no matter what I tried to encourage clumping, my curls that were once effortlessly shiny and clumped-together became stringy and frizzy. Most days, I would eventually give up and just end up straightening. Recently, I guess out of pure curiosity, I took my ol' reliable Wet brush out of the drawer and, after clarifying and putting in some of my favorite leave-in conditioner (Garnier Fructis air-dry butter cream- the one in the green bottle with the purple cap and coconuts on it), I brushed through my wet hair with the Wet brush. Even as I was brushing it, I noticed the clumping and definition were AMAZING. Finally, my hair once again dried in fat ringlets. I had thought it was irreparable heat damage, meanwhile I was using the wrong brush. I know this was a long story, I just wanted to point out how truly wonderful the Wet brush is.
